Understanding the Nuances Behind Curacao’s Licensing Appeal
Curacao has long been a hotspot for online gambling operators seeking accessible licensing. Its appeal lies in relatively straightforward regulations and faster approval processes compared to more stringent jurisdictions. However, this simplicity comes with a trade-off—questions about oversight and player protections often arise. Many online casino enthusiasts find themselves wondering: what does it truly mean when a platform operates under a Curacao license?
The license covers a wide array of operators, from small startups to established brands running games from providers like Pragmatic Play and Play’n GO. This variety can be both enticing and confusing for players. Trustworthiness and transparency, key values in regulated gambling, don’t always come easy to verify in this environment.
The Player Experience: Unexpected Twists and Turns
Engaging with curacao online casinos often means navigating unpredictable elements. Bonus terms may differ considerably, withdrawal times can be inconsistent, and customer support responsiveness varies widely. Some casinos focus on popular titles such as NetEnt’s Starburst or Evolution’s live dealer games, while others rely on lesser-known providers, which might affect the overall gameplay quality.
Another curious aspect is payment methods. Many platforms accept cryptocurrencies alongside traditional options like Visa or e-wallets, which adds convenience but also complexity in terms of security and transaction verification. For example, some players report delays or additional checks when using newer digital wallets.
Of course, these inconsistencies do not necessarily indicate malpractice but highlight the importance of cautious engagement. Key Considerations for Players: What to Watch Out For
There’s no magic formula to picking the perfect casino under the Curacao license, but a few practical tips can ease the journey:
- Verify the casino’s licensing information and check for transparency in ownership.
- Look for clear terms regarding bonuses, wagering requirements, and withdrawal limits.
- Test customer support responsiveness before committing significant funds.
- Favor casinos offering well-known game providers with established reputations.
- Ensure secure payment options are available and understand the withdrawal process thoroughly.
Players often underestimate the importance of these steps. From my experience, overlooking them can lead to frustration and unexpected hurdles, especially when dealing with withdrawal delays or unclear rules.
The Role of Technology and Game Providers in Shaping Trust
One cannot discuss this sector without acknowledging how providers influence player confidence. Giants like Evolution and NetEnt bring a sense of legitimacy and quality to online platforms, which is crucial when regulatory oversight is less visible. Their games usually come with higher RTPs—often around 96% or more—and robust security measures embedded in the software.
Meanwhile, the proliferation of smaller or less familiar studios presents an intriguing dynamic. While some offer innovation and fresh gameplay, others may raise eyebrows regarding fairness or software reliability. For players keen on long-term engagement, sticking to casinos featuring a mix of trusted developers might be the safer option.
Responsible Gaming Within the Curacao Framework
Gambling should always be approached with caution, and the relatively fluid nature of Curacao’s licensing means players must take extra responsibility. Setting limits, understanding the odds, and knowing when to step back are universal principles that become even more critical here. Many platforms provide tools to help manage playtime and spending, but self-awareness remains the most effective safeguard.
In addition, while Curacao’s regulatory body does impose certain requirements, its framework does not always guarantee the same level of protection found in stricter jurisdictions. It’s wise to treat online gambling as a form of entertainment rather than a reliable source of income.
